What you could also do, is to take a look at the mod files, themself. Go to your steam folder and open steamapps/workshop/content/394360/2017394128/gfx/entities. There should be 5 files:
german_colonies_artillery.asset; german_colonies_vehicle.asset; NMB_camelry.asset; NMB_units_infantry.asset and schutztruppe.gfx open each of them with a text editor, if the text is legible, I'd assume the file is in order. If it is a random jumble of letters, or if the file is empty, delete the file and verify the game files, that should download it again.
